Administración de un clúster - Guía para desarrolladores de AWS Snowball Edge

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

Administración de un clúster

En las secciones siguientes se proporciona información sobre las principales tareas administrativas que se necesitan para operar un clúster en buen estado de dispositivos Snowball Edge.

La mayoría de las tareas administrativas requieren que utilice el cliente de Snowball Edge y sus comandos para llevar a cabo las siguientes acciones:

Lectura y escritura de datos en un clúster

Una vez que se ha desbloqueado un clúster, está listo para leer y escribir datos en él. Puede utilizar la interfaz de Amazon S3 para leer y escribir datos en un clúster. Para obtener más información, consulte Transferencia de archivos mediante la interfaz de Amazon S3.

Para escribir datos en un clúster, debe tener un cuórum de lectura/escritura con un nodo no disponible como máximo. Para leer datos de un clúster, debe tener un cuórum de lectura de no más de dos nodos no disponibles. Para obtener más información sobre los cuórum, consulte.Cuórum de clúster de bolas de nieve.

Reconexión de un nodo de clúster no disponible

Un nodo puede no estar disponible temporalmente debido a un problema (como una pérdida de red o de alimentación eléctrica) sin que los datos del nodo sufran ningún daño. Cuando esto sucede, afecta al estado del clúster. El cliente de Snowball Edge notifica el estado de bloqueo y de acceso a la red de un nodo mediante elsnowballEdge describe-clustercomando.

Le recomendamos que sitúe el clúster físicamente de forma que tenga acceso a las partes delantera, posterior y superior de todos los nodos. De esta forma, puede obtener acceso a los cables de alimentación eléctrica y de red de la parte posterior, a la etiqueta de envío de la parte superior para obtener el ID del nodo y a la pantalla LCD de la parte delantera del dispositivo para obtener la dirección IP y otros datos administrativos.

Cuando se detecta que un nodo no está disponible, recomendamos intentar uno de los siguientes procedimientos, según cuál esa la situación causante de la falta de disponibilidad.

Para volver a conectar un nodo no disponible

  1. Asegúrese de que el nodo reciba alimentación eléctrica.

  2. Asegúrese de que el nodo esté conectado a la misma red interna que el resto del clúster.

  3. Si ha tenido que encender el nodo, espere a que finalice la velocidad de encendido.

  4. Ejecute el comando snowballEdge unlock-cluster o el comando snowballEdge associate-device. Para ver un ejemplo, consulte Desbloquear dispositivos Snowball Edge.

Para volver a conectar un nodo no disponible que ha perdido la conexión a la red pero no se ha apagado

  1. Asegúrese de que el nodo esté conectado a la misma red interna que el resto del clúster.

  2. Ejecute el comando snowballEdge describe-device para comprobar cuándo se vuelve a agregar al clúster el nodo que no estaba disponible. Para ver un ejemplo, consulte Obtención del estado de los dispositivos.

Una vez que se llevan cabo los procedimientos anteriores, los nodos deberían funcionar correctamente. Además, debe tener cuórum de lectura/escritura. Si no es así, es posible que uno o varios de los nodos del clúster presente un problema más grave, en cuyo caso podría ser preciso eliminarlo del clúster.

Eliminación de un nodo en mal estado de un clúster

En raras ocasiones, uno de los nodos del clúster podría encontrarse en mal estado. Si el nodo no está disponible, recomendamos seguir previamente los procedimientos indicados en Reconexión de un nodo de clúster no disponible.

Si el problema persiste, puede ser que el nodo se encuentre en mal estado. Un nodo puede encontrarse en mal estado si ha sufrido daños procedentes de una fuente externa, debido a algún problema eléctrico inusual o a un hecho improbable semejante. Si esto ocurre, es necesario eliminar el nodo del clúster para poder añadir otro nuevo que lo sustituya.

Cuando se detecta que un nodo se encuentra en mal estado y es preciso eliminarlo, recomendamos seguir el procedimiento que se indica a continuación.

Para eliminar un nodo en mal estado

  1. Asegúrese de que el nodo se encuentra en mal estado y que no sea simplemente que no está disponible. Para obtener más información, consulte Reconexión de un nodo de clúster no disponible.

  2. Desconecte el nodo en mal estado de la red y apáguelo.

  3. Ejecute lasnowballEdge dissassociate-deviceOrden del cliente de Snowball Edge. Para obtener más información, consulte Eliminación de un nodo de un clúster.

  4. Utilice la consola, la lista para solicitar un nodo de repuestoAWS CLI, o uno de losAWSSDK de.

  5. Devuelva el nodo en mal estado aAWS. Cuando recibamos el nodo, llevaremos a cabo un borrado completo del dispositivo. Esta operación de borrado se ajusta a los estándares 800-88 del Instituto Nacional de Normalización y Tecnología (NIST).

Después de eliminar un nodo correctamente, los siguen estando disponibles en el clúster si dispone de cuórum de lectura. Para disponer de cuórum de lectura, un clúster no debe tener más de dos nodos no disponibles. Por lo tanto, se recomienda solicitar nodos de repuesto tan pronto como se haya eliminado un nodo no disponible del clúster.

Adición o sustitución de un nodo de un clúster

Puede agregar un nuevo nodo después de haber eliminado un nodo en mal estado de un clúster. También puede agregar un nuevo nodo para aumentar el almacenamiento local.

Para agregar un nuevo nodo, antes debe solicitar un repuesto. Puede utilizar la consola para solicitar un nodo de repuesto, elAWS CLI, o uno de losAWSSDK de. Si solicita un nodo de repuesto desde la consola, puede solicitar repuestos para cualquier trabajo que no se haya cancelado o completado.

Para solicitar un nodo de repuesto desde la consola

  1. Inicie sesión en Consola de administración de la familia de productos Snow de AWS.

  2. Busque y elija un trabajo para un nodo que pertenezca al clúster que ha creado en el panel Job.

  3. En Actions (Acciones), elija Replace node (Reemplazar nodo).

    Con ello se abre el último paso del asistente de creación de trabajo, exactamente con los mismos ajustes que al crear el clúster original.

  4. Seleccione Create job (Crear trabajo).

El dispositivo Snowball Edge de repuesto ya está en camino. Cuando lo reciba, utilice el siguiente procedimiento para agregarlo al clúster.

Para añadir de un nodo de repuesto

  1. Coloque el nuevo nodo del clúster de tal forma que tenga acceso a la parte delantera, posterior y superior de todos los nodos.

  2. Asegúrese de que el nodo reciba alimentación eléctrica.

  3. Asegúrese de que el nodo esté conectado a la misma red interna que el resto del clúster.

  4. Si ha tenido que encender el nodo, espere a que finalice la velocidad de encendido.

  5. Ejecute el comando snowballEdge associate-device. Para ver un ejemplo, consulte Adición de un nodo a un clúster.